Discover the ultimate finger food with these Paleo Breaded Chicken Wings—crispy, flavorful, and completely grain-free! Perfect for those following a Paleo diet, this recipe swaps traditional breadcrumbs for a savory blend of almond flour and coconut flour, seasoned with garlic, onion powder, paprika, and a hint of black pepper. Coated in beaten eggs and baked to golden perfection with a drizzle of coconut oil, these wings are rich in flavor and satisfyingly crunchy without the need for frying. With just 15 minutes of prep and 30 minutes in the oven, these wings make an effortless yet impressive appetizer or game-day snack. 🥘 Ingredients

10 items
  • 12 pieces chicken wings
  • 1 cup almond flour
  • 1 tablespoon coconut flour
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on black pepper
  • 2 large eggs
  • 0.25 cup coconut oil

📝 Instructions

9 steps
1

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

2

In a shallow bowl, combine the almond flour, coconut flour, gar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and black pepper. Mix well to ensure the spices are evenly distributed.

3

In a separate shallow bowl, beat the eggs until smooth.

4

Pat the chicken wings dry with paper towels. This will help the coating adhere better.

5

Dip each chicken wing first into the beaten eggs, allowing any excess to drip off, and then thoroughly coat it in the almond flour mixture. Press the flour mixture onto the wings to ensure they are well coated.

6

Place the breaded wings onto the prepared baking sheet, ensuring they are not touching each other.

7

Melt the coconut oil and drizzle it over the wings to help them crisp up in the oven.

8

Bake the wings in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es or until they are golden brown and cooked through, flipping halfway through the cooking time to ensure even browning.

9

Once baked, remove from the oven and let rest for a few minutes before serving. Enjoy your Paleo Breaded Chicken Wings with a side of your favorite Paleo-friendly dipping sauce or salad.
